Optimized Dispatch Schedule for Autonomous Grids in Isolated Islands

2016 
The rapid development of wind power provides a new solution for power supply of isolated island. However, due to the intermittent and stochastic nature of renewable energy resources (RES), the energy storage unit (ESU) is required for power grid reliability. This paper proposed an automatic programming method for autonomous grid in isolated islands. The sea water pumped storage plant serves as ESU to counter-balance the fluctuations of RESs. The penetration level of RES and the profit of the Island system operator (ISO) increase significantly. With the geographical and historical data of an island in China, the effectiveness of the proposed method is testified.
